Bayern Munich have secured the Bundesliga title, celebrating at both the Allianz Arena and with a quick trip to Ibiza, with a Marienplatz parade still to come. However, a hectic summer lies ahead. After a short break, Bayern will gear up for the FIFA Club World Cup in the U.S., just before the summer transfer window opens in July. Preparations for the 2025/26 season are already underway, with both tournament commitments and transfer business taking center stage.
The club's top transfer target remains Bayer Leverkusen star Florian Wirtz. Meanwhile, departures could also be on the cards, with center-back Dayot Upamecano linked to a move to Paris Saint-Germain. The Ligue 1 champions and Champions League finalists are reportedly monitoring his situation, especially as contract talks with Bayern have stalled, and are keen on adding the French international to bolster their defense.
